Shrewsbury, Milk Street 1911

Many street names were derived from the products traded in them. Here milk and dairy products were sold. Other similar local names are Fish Street and Butcher Row. Sometimes names changed. Who would want to live in Swine Street, no matter how smart the houses? It therefore changed to St John's Hill - much more elegant.
